3、 15444-9 specifies JPIP, the JPEG 2000 client/server communication protocol. Corrigendum 1 provides corrections and clarifications for the metadata transfers between the server and client and for the colour space method preferences. 14、DATION Information technology JPEG 2000 image coding system: Interactivity tools, APIs and protocols Technical Corrigendum 1 1) Annex A.3.2.1 Add the following note at the end of the clause: NOTE For the sake of efficiency when serving an image containing PPM markers, a server may transcode the pack

15、ed packet headers in the main header into the tile headers (PPT markers). Otherwise, a client would require tile-part length markers (TLM) to be sent. The server may alternatively transcode the image (transparently to the client) in such a way as to avoid the use of packed packet headers altogether.

16、 2) Annex A.3.3 Replace the sentence: This data bin may be formed from a legal codestream, by concatenating all marker segments except SOT and POC in all tile-part headers for tile n. with: This data bin may be formed from a legal codestream, by concatenating all marker segments except SOT in all ti

17、le-part headers for tile n. NOTE 1 POC marker segments may also be removed as they are not required by a typical JPIP client. However, a server might need to include the POC markers for a client application that was to output a JPEG 2000 file with the same progression order as the original image ava

18、ilable at the server. A server may send data in any order, but must send a tile header data bin for a tile even if the tile header is empty. NOTE 2 A client that receives image data for a tile but has not yet received its tile header should not assume that the tile header is empty and attempt to dec

19、ode the data. It might be beneficial for certain clients to receive the tile header bin in advance of the tile data bin. 3) Annex A.3.6.1 Add the following sentence at the end of the clause: A server is required to send at least the metadata bin with bin Id 0, even if no metadata is present. In this

20、 case, the metabin #0 will be empty. NOTE 2 A client should not assume that no metadata is available if it has not yet received any metadata bin. It might be beneficial for certain clients to receive the metadata bin with bin Id 0 in advance to all other bins. 4) Annex C.3.4 Add the following note a

21、t the end of the clause: NOTE The combination of “wait = yes“ with “cclose=*“ is not recommended. If this situation is encountered, the application can decide which of the two takes priority. ISO/IEC 15444-9:2005/Cor.1:2007 (E) 2 ITU-T Rec. T.808 (2005)/Cor.1 (01/2007) 5) Annex C.5.1 Replace the fol

22、lowing sentence at the end of the first paragraph: Where the server is aware of additional relevant metadata elements, it may deliver these as well. with the following note: NOTE The list of boxes defined in this clause is not exhaustive. Additional boxes may be required to decode the requested view

23、 window within the logical target correctly. 6) Annex C.7.2 Add the following note at the end of the clause: NOTE The combination of “wait = yes“ with “cclose=*“ is not recommended. If this situation is encountered, the application can decide which of the two takes priority. 7) Annex C.8.1.3 The fol

24、lowing sentence should be added to the beginning of the first paragraph: Implicit bin-descriptors are only applicable to JPP-stream requests. 8) Annex C.10.2.3 Change the contents of the boxes “Use unmodified value“ and “Use modified value“ of Figure C.3 as follows: Change: Use unmodified value prio

25、rityi = speci.APPROX + speci.PREC to: Use unmodified value priorityi = speci.APPROX + 256 speci.PREC Change: Use modified value priorityi = 1 + speci.PREC to: Use modified value priorityi = 257 speci.PREC The body of the text shall remain unaltered.
